如何在iPhone应用程序中通过修改图像像素值在UIImage上添加色调效果

如何在iPhone应用程序中通过修改图像像素值在UIImage上添加色调效果,iphone,objective-c,c,cocoa-touch,Iphone,Objective C,C,Cocoa Touch,想在iPhone应用程序中添加色调过滤器吗 我想写一个代码,通过修改图像的像素值,添加不同色调值参数值的色调图像效果。我怎样才能做到这一点。 总的来说,我想通过操纵图像的每个像素值来添加色调图像过滤器。但在添加色调效果时,像素的实际值是多少 您需要使用CoreImage,特别是CIFilter。 网上有很多例子,但苹果开发者网站上有一个例子完全符合你的要求: 转到并检查“创建CIFilter对象和设置值”一节,其中显示了如何为给定图像创建色调过滤器

想在iPhone应用程序中添加色调过滤器吗 我想写一个代码,通过修改图像的像素值,添加不同色调值参数值的色调图像效果。我怎样才能做到这一点。
总的来说,我想通过操纵图像的每个像素值来添加色调图像过滤器。但在添加色调效果时,像素的实际值是多少

您需要使用CoreImage,特别是CIFilter。 网上有很多例子,但苹果开发者网站上有一个例子完全符合你的要求:

转到并检查“创建CIFilter对象和设置值”一节,其中显示了如何为给定图像创建色调过滤器